Transaction fbaa91b3e59f395aadc0c4ec491b6a71d9f7a8575f3cfcd56554aee18d9e1d16
1 Input
1 Output
-
fbaa91b3e59f395aadc0c4ec491b6a71d9f7a8575f3cfcd56554aee18d9e1d16:0
- value
- 336214239
- script pubkey
- OP_0 OP_PUSHBYTES_20 16883c2d5f3e56828da02b0e7f677bf84125b654
- address
- bc1qz6yrct2l8etg9rdq9v887emmlpqjtdj5cj72sn